/* line 21, ../../src/sass/entryBody.scss */
article.entryBody > :is(h1, h2, h3, h4, h5, h6):first-child {
  margin-top: 0;
}
/* line 26, ../../src/sass/entryBody.scss */
article.entryBody .dateCate {
  display: flex;
  align-items: center;
  gap: var(--spacing-s, 16px);
  align-self: stretch;
  justify-content: flex-end;
  margin-bottom: var(--contents-margin-default);
}
/* line 35, ../../src/sass/entryBody.scss */
article.entryBody .dateCate .date {
  font-family: var(--title);
  font-size: var(--txt_big);
  font-style: normal;
  font-weight: 400;
  line-height: 180%;
}
/* line 40, ../../src/sass/entryBody.scss */
article.entryBody .dateCate .cate {
  display: flex;
  width: calc(var(--vw) * 10.41667);
  padding: var(--spacing-xxs, 4px) var(--spacing-s, 16px);
  justify-content: center;
  align-items: center;
  gap: 10px;
  border: 1px solid var(--white, #fff);
  background: var(--black);
  color: var(--white);
  font-family: var(--title);
  font-size: calc(var(--vw) * 0.72917);
  font-style: normal;
  font-weight: 400;
  line-height: 1;
}
@media screen and (max-width: 820px) {
  /* line 40, ../../src/sass/entryBody.scss */
  article.entryBody .dateCate .cate {
    width: calc(var(--vw) * 23.4375);
  }
}
@media screen and (max-width: 500px) {
  /* line 40, ../../src/sass/entryBody.scss */
  article.entryBody .dateCate .cate {
    width: calc(var(--vw) * 42.66667);
  }
}
@media screen and (max-width: 1440px) {
  /* line 40, ../../src/sass/entryBody.scss */
  article.entryBody .dateCate .cate {
    font-size: calc(var(--vw) * 0.97222);
  }
}
@media screen and (max-width: 820px) {
  /* line 40, ../../src/sass/entryBody.scss */
  article.entryBody .dateCate .cate {
    font-size: calc(var(--vw) * 1.82292);
  }
}
@media screen and (max-width: 500px) {
  /* line 40, ../../src/sass/entryBody.scss */
  article.entryBody .dateCate .cate {
    font-size: calc(var(--vw) * 3.73333);
  }
}
/* line 43, ../../src/sass/entryBody.scss */
article.entryBody .dateCate .cate.inv {
  background-color: var(--white);
  color: var(--black);
  border: 1px solid var(--black);
}
/* line 50, ../../src/sass/entryBody.scss */
article.entryBody .dateCate + h1 {
  margin-top: var(--spacing-m);
}
/* line 55, ../../src/sass/entryBody.scss */
article.entryBody .blocks {
  margin-top: var(--spacing-xl);
  display: flex;
  width: var(--contents);
  flex-direction: column;
  align-items: stretch;
  gap: var(--spacing-xl, 64px);
}
/* line 64, ../../src/sass/entryBody.scss */
article.entryBody .btmNav {
  text-align: center;
  margin-top: var(--contents-margin-default);
}
